US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"private conversation"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to refer to a discussion that is intended to be confidential or not shared with others. Example: "We need to have a private conversation about the upcoming project and its sensitive details."

FAQs

How can I use "private conversation" in a sentence?

You can use "private conversation" to describe a discussion intended to be confidential. For example: "We had a "private conversation" about the company's future plans".

What's the difference between "private conversation" and "public discussion"?

"Private conversation" implies confidentiality and limited participants, while "public discussion" suggests an open forum accessible to many.

What can I say instead of "private conversation"?

Alternatives include "confidential discussion", "personal dialogue", or "secret tête-à-tête" depending on the context.

Is it redundant to say "very private conversation"?

While not strictly redundant, "very private conversation" can add emphasis. However, consider whether the "private" nature is already clear from the context.
